2001 S430 Airmatic pump wont stop!
I am having a problem with my S430. The airmatic pump in front of the front right wheel will not shut off, and required me to pull the battery cable as it was draining the battery -and the pump was about to catch fire! I must add that i had the car in the shop the same day... and this problem started the 1st time i drove it away from the shop. I just had the front brakes and rotors replaced. Could this somehow be related? Does anyone think that they mechanic could have accidentally done something to cause this? The pump is now most likely totally shot( due the the burning smell) if anyone can assist with this before i call them tomorrow and have it towed in. i would greatly appreciate it.
#3
i think its relay O they are labeled under the relay. pull that then your good. usually when the pump continuosly runs it can be because the relay burned up. and then the motor keeps running and burns itself out too. if it gets hot enough the electrical connector will melt together and that sucks.

brakes and suspension related?
my hubby also had just done brakes a week before these suspension issues and was wondering if somehow the raising of the car and the hanging of the wheels and load change could have elevated or caused the problem with the suspension having failures...? any really sharp benz techs out there know if these are related?? help! please!
#5
yes alot of times if the front suspension strut are starting to leak air and you raise up the car they can leak, but will fill back up when put back on the ground. the technician did nothing to cause your problem. just coincidence.
